What is cell differentiation or specialization?

What is cell differentiation or specialization?

Cell differentiation describes the process of specialization leading to the formation of brain, heart, and all other tissues from the single-cell zygote and the primitive, three-layered embryo.

What are examples of cell specialization?

Blood cells are an example of specialization within a system of the body and include red blood cells, white blood cells, and platelets. Red blood cells, for instance, specialize in carrying oxygen throughout the body.

Why is cell differentiation important to organisms?

Cell differentiation is the process of stem cells becoming more specialized. Cell differentiation is important because it creates diversity in life on Earth, creates diversity within the cells of our body and allows cells to create unique structures that fit their individualized functions.
